We had a terrifically exhilarating, amazing (and exhausting) time at PrezCon. Due to great player feedback, we made a few changes:

  • Storm Tokens: At PrezCon we experimented with changing from a 3-part day (morning, afternoon and evening) to a 2-part day (a.m./p.m.). Because of this change, we needed 2-sided storm tokens and they were a hit! Players found them easier to move and see on the board.
Larger storm tokens on board.
Storm tokens are now larger, 2-sided pieces.
  • Event Cards: Early in the PrezCon week, players still had to play a card to discard it. However, if a player didn’t like a card in their hand they had to play it – and spend Qi – to get a new one. That mechanic just wasn’t working so mid-week we introduced a new rule: Players can discard an event card for a new one. They can then play an event card again on the next turn!
